Output 7cabc3c51280dc4e7e552418812dffd8a1b92be96c585d30afe5caa3f78e4016:0

value
182022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0980c2c32e5fad7e396fd39b6d506cb2b074611e OP_EQUAL
address
32ZGFj7EsT6frvGsMW7tSZR3WFE5Eqysz4
transaction
7cabc3c51280dc4e7e552418812dffd8a1b92be96c585d30afe5caa3f78e4016
confirmations
138208
spent
true